Summarized by AI from the source belowRado, owned by Swatch Group (SWG), launched its Integral watch to commemorate 40 years of high-tech ceramic innovations. Since its 1986 debut, over 2 million Integral pieces have been sold. Rado's watches are priced between $1,200 and $6,000, with an average around $2,500 to $2,800. The company recently established a high-tech ceramic lab in Boncourt, Switzerland, which produces 80 to 90 percent of its ceramic products, enhancing its capacity and quality assurance in the affordable luxury segment.
